Configure the Graphical user interface (GUI) behavior of ESET Server Security. You can adjust the program's visual appearance and effects.
Use the GUI start mode drop-down menu to select from the following Graphical user interface (GUI) start modes:
•Full - The complete GUI will be displayed.
•Terminal - No notifications or alerts will be displayed. GUI can only be started by the Administrator. The user interface should be set to Terminal if graphical elements slow the performance of your computer or cause other problems. You may also want to turn off the GUI on a Terminal server. Show splash-screen at startup
Disable this option if you prefer not to have the splash-screen displayed when GUI of your ESET Server Security starts, for example when logging into the system.
Use sound signal
ESET Server Security plays a sound when important events occur during a scan, for example, when a threat is discovered or when the scan has finished.
Integrate into the context menu
When enabled, ESET Server Security control elements are integrated into the context menu. The context menu is displayed after right-clicking an object (file). The menu lists all of the actions that you can perform on an object.
Application statuses
Click Edit to select statuses that are displayed in the Monitoring window. Alternatively, you can use ESET PROTECT policies to configure your application statutes. An application status will also be displayed if your product is not activated or if your license has expired.
License Information / Show license information
When enabled, messages and notifications about your license will be displayed.

Alerts and message boxes
By configuring Alerts and notifications, you can change the behavior of detected threat alerts and system notifications. These can be customized to fit your needs. If you choose not to display some notifications, they will be displayed in the Disabled messages and statuses area. Here you can check their status, show more details or remove them from this window.
Access setup
You can prevent any unauthorized changes using the Access setup tool to ensure that security remains high.
ESET Shell
You can configure access rights to product settings, features and data via eShell by changing the ESET Shell execution policy.
